LOOKOR.COM: A Robertson-based Supplier of Tool Hire, Toilet Hire, Scaffolding and Branding Services
LOOKOR.COM operates as a long-standing supplier in the Western Cape, specialising in mobile facilities, construction tools, scaffolding, and branding services. Based in Robertson, the company supplies a broad range of rental equipment tailored to both large-scale projects and smaller sites. The business emphasises practical solutions for construction and events, with additional capability in branding and on-site support to help projects run smoothly from start to finish.
The company presents itself as a multipurpose provider with four core service areas. Tool hire covers construction, DIY, home improvement and gardening equipment. Toilet hire includes mobile ablution facilities suitable for construction sites and events, available in several configurations. Scaffolding is offered for safety-focused construction work and for crowd control or event needs. The branding division provides embroidery and print services to create professional appearance for uniforms, signage and vehicles. These offerings position LOOKOR.COM as a one-stop rental and branding partner for clients working across the Boland region and surrounding areas.
Main services offered
- Tool Hire – A broad selection of construction tools, DIY and home improvement tools, plus gardening equipment to meet various project requirements.
- Toilet Hire – Mobile and event toilet solutions with several unit types, including options with wash basins; a weekly tank cleaning service is included where applicable.
- Scaffolding – Scaffolding systems and related access equipment for construction safety and event use, with weekly rental available and a range of components (frames, boards, connectors, supports) listed as standard stock.
- Branding – In-house branding capabilities featuring embroidery and printing on fabrics and accessories, alongside vehicle branding to help organisations present a professional image.
Additional details indicate on-site support and solutions for both large projects and smaller sites. The business markets itself as able to transport equipment to and from job sites, undertake routine cleaning and maintenance of toilets, and offer both long-term and short-term rental options to suit project timelines.

Hours, location and service area
The business operates from 11 Wolhuter Street, Robertson (6705) and follows standard business hours listed as Mondays to Fridays, 8am to 5pm, with additional contact details provided for enquiries. The service area spans the greater Langeberg region, including Robertson, Ashton, Bonnivale, McGregor, Montagu and nearby communities, with delivery, maintenance and collection available to these locations.
